[QUOTE="Mat, post: 1323177, member: 21445"]I was never in the market for a lifetime issue of Faustina Sr. but this one had popped up a few months ago & I saw it in my usual new listing run, and this isnt Ebay. After thinking about I knew something was special about it. Instead of the usual [B]Peacock beneath throne and scepter behind, this was seated on throne.[/B] not a single online reference had this particular type & only one on a old CNG auction mixed lot, which was actually this coin. Well I bought the coin and thanks to Ardatirion & Curtis Clay, it is indeed a fairly rare type. Below is the Curtis writeup & of course the coin. [IMG]http://i39.tinypic.com/33xvjbb.jpg[/IMG] FAUSTINA Sr. (138-141 AD) AR Denarius Lifetime Issue O: FAVSTINA AVGVSTA Draped bust right. O:IVNONI REGINAE Peacock seated on throne and scepter behind. 18mm 3.5g RIC-340, RSC-221 BMC (Antoninus Pius) 145 (same reverse die) Ex Robert Kutcher Collection (Triton X, 8 January 2007), lot 1606 (part of)[/QUOTE]
